Description

$ tt connect var/run/router-001/tarantool.control
   ⨯ tt.yaml not found

@oleg-jukovec points me that I should use ./var/run/router-001/tarantool.control.

However, if the file exists, it is quite natural to assume that I want to connect to an instance using the file.
